  • Page 9: Signal Loss And Calibration

    User Manual MCx-B-xxxAx-8.09 Signal Loss and Calibration 1. In the event of a power loss, the battery fail-safe model will move to its designated fail-position. This position is programmed at the factory (based on user request) and cannot be changed in the field. IF YOU HAVE TO turn the actuator manually when its power is turned off, it will lose its position, and it will need to be re-zeroed (as described in sub-section 3).
